For Darryl Raynard Richardson III, better known as Lil Scrappy, one influential figure in his life is his mother, the formidable Deborah Bryant, affectionately known as Momma Dee.
The Queen of Reality TV
Momma Dee, born on September 21, 1963, in Brooklyn, New York, has carved out her own place in the world of entertainment. She is not only an actress and singer but is perhaps best known for her appearances on the popular VH1 reality show “Love & Hip Hop: Atlanta.” Her magnetic personality and memorable moments on the show have made her a beloved figure among reality TV enthusiasts.
